Preparation
-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- In a large bowl, beat the softened butter and brown sugar until smooth and glossy.
- Add the mashed bananas, egg, and vanilla to the mixture and combine until smooth.
- In a separate bowl, whisk together the flour, baking soda, cinnamon, and salt.
- Gradually mix the dry ingredients into the wet ingredients until just combined. Fold in the chocolate chips if using.
- Drop spoonfuls of dough onto the prepared baking sheet, spacing them about 2 inches apart.
Baking
- Bake for 10–12 minutes, until edges are golden and centers are set but still soft.
- Let the cookies cool on the baking sheet for a few min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.
Notes
For best results, mash bananas until mostly smooth, and ensure butter is softened. Do not overbake to maintain chewiness.
